Yearly banquet raises $77,000 for conservation efforts

Friday, March 18, 2016
Outdoor enthusiasts of all ages took time to drop tickets in collection buckets in hopes of winning rifles, original artwork and other prizes featured at Saturday's event.

People from Mountain Home and communities across southern Idaho gathered on Saturday during a yearly event aimed at promoting big game habitat and restoration.

More than 350 people packed into the Mountain Home Elks Lodge that evening during the Rocky Mountain Elk Foundation Banquet.
